Guide users step by step inside your product.
NINA is an innovative in-product guidance tool designed for B2B SaaS companies aiming to enhance user onboarding and support experiences. Unlike traditional tutorials, chatbots, or static FAQs, NINA lives within the product interface, offering real-time, contextual assistance. Users can ask questions via voice or text when they encounter difficulties, and NINA provides step-by-step guidance directly on the live interface. This approach reduces reliance on support tickets, onboarding calls, and help documentation, streamlining the user journey and fostering higher engagement. NINA is especially valuable for SaaS teams seeking to improve customer success and reduce support workload by empowering users to solve problems independently. Its dynamic, non-scripted nature ensures tailored, relevant support that adapts to each user's specific context, making onboarding more intuitive and support more efficient.

Best installer for OpenClaw agents across all your chat apps
Ara streamlines the integration of OpenClaw agents such as ClawdBot and MoltBot across multiple chat platforms, making it effortless to connect and automate tasks on WhatsApp, iMessage, and more. Designed for busy professionals, marketers, and developers, it eliminates hours of manual setup with a single-command installation process. Once installed, users can automate tasks, run custom code, or send emails seamlessly within their messaging apps, effectively turning their chat platforms into powerful AI-driven productivity hubs. Its simplicity and versatility make it a standout tool for anyone looking to enhance communication workflows or build personal AI agents without technical hassle. With a focus on ease of use and broad platform support, Ara positions itself as a game-changer for personal and small business automation.
